Councilman Larry Roth Recognized Officer Christopher Cosio As “Officer Of The Month” For August 2023

In a moving ceremony dedicated to honoring outstanding service and commitment to the community, Councilman Larry Roth proudly recognized Officer Christopher Cosio as the "Officer of the Month" for August 2023. In recognition of his outstanding contributions, Officer Christopher Cosio received a plaque during the presentation that highlighted Officer Cosio's remarkable dedication and selflessness in his line of duty.

Councilman Roth took the stage to acknowledge Officer Christopher Cosio's exceptional performance during August 2023. The Officer of the Month award is a prestigious recognition reserved for those who consistently go above and beyond their regular duties to serve and protect the community.

Officer Cosio, who joined the Homestead Police Department in December 2013 after serving with the South Miami Police Department, has been a valuable asset to the force, currently serving in uniform patrol on the day shift.

During August, Officer Cosio demonstrated his commitment to the community in two notable incidents. On August 15th, he played a pivotal role in resolving a stolen FedEx truck incident. He demonstrated outstanding teamwork and professionalism. Six days later, Officer Cosio faced a heart-wrenching situation involving a 10-month-old child in distress. His quick thinking and life-saving actions ensured the child's well-being.

Councilman Roth and the entire Homestead Police Department celebrated Officer Christopher Cosio's exemplary service, recognizing him as a role model for his colleagues. His dedication and unwavering commitment epitomize the values upheld by the department.

Officer Cosio expressed his gratitude to Chief Alexander Rolle and the chain of command for the opportunity to serve with the Homestead Police Department. He also extended his heartfelt thanks to his wife, whose support made his dream of joining the Homestead Police force a reality.
